My illusion/kinetics controller was probably my fave. It occurred to me one day that, instead of directing a measly six brain-damaged pets as a mastermind, I could use /kinetics to supercharge an entire team (or taskforce) of intelligent "player-pets" into a finely-tuned killing machine. Add Phantasm, Phantom Army and a situational pair of Lore Pets to the equation and the result was a screen full of exquisitely-buffed mayhem-makers. Mwahahahahaa!

-Ahem-

The runner-up toon was probably my electric/fire blapper. Switch on Hot Feet and Blazing Aura, wait for the tank to take the alpha, then literally hop into the middle of a pack and cut loose with an embarrassing arsenal of AoE attacks (Fire Sword Circle, Short Circuit, Combustion, Ball Lightning, sometimes Bonfire). And die, often enough...only to pop Rise of the Phoenix and have the last laugh. Not that most mobs would last that long except at +3/4 or in itrials, but it sure was fun when it all clicked. And Melee Core Embodiment would occasionally turn her into an unstoppable volcanic Cuisinart.

Back when CoV first arrived, I started a corruptor named Sajaana on Triumph (energy/kinetics).  She was instantly the most popular girl in the Rogue Isles.

She could Heal!  She could Solo!  She could do Damage!  She could even do some light Tanking!  She could do any job you asked her to do.

Corruptors were some of what I would call the best "eighth villains," and later, "eighth heroes" in the game, from my standpoint.  By that I mean, if you have your basic damage sink (tanker, MM and brute), your damage dealer (blasters, dominators, controllers and scrappers), and your healer (defender), the corruptor was a great archetype to fill in the remainder of the group slots.  Because the corruptor could do a little bit of everything and could fill in anywhere when someone went down.

Of course, a lot of ATs were like that.  The ATs in CoH weren't, as a rule, one role builds.  They could do many roles, even ones they weren't 'designed' to do.
